Next some making of this drawing, hopefully it helps someone somehow. 


Here is how the composition and colours work. 
Composition (green): I put the attention on the center of the image.  I used the elements like: mountains, cape and the thunders to point towards Thor's head-chest. Now, the thunders work a bit different because they point to the Mjolnir (hammer) then from there the arm brings us again to Thor's head-chest.  
Colour (red): Again the colours meet in the center of the drawing. It travels from the Blue all the way to the Yellow meeting each other in the center.

More Acrylic


Another Sunday with Acrylics. This time trying more colors and filling more the page, not worrying about cutting the drawing out of the page. Also painted every part with a different tool: some brushes, napkins, by finger and some charcoal for whites.
